Output 59444880c2d37de46842465041bbbc559239525bebfc4290cc0c5dfd0900a0be:0

value
2821806276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 518d3aa670c15c0cd1cbdf05e7a0253a12aceac5 OP_EQUAL
address
398DqrNc64n9ZviCKbva4qXh84YQ5hkkzo
transaction
59444880c2d37de46842465041bbbc559239525bebfc4290cc0c5dfd0900a0be
confirmations
358465
spent
true